Start Smart: Booking Flights and Transportation

Master the Art of Flight Booking

Your airfare often represents the largest chunk of your travel budget, making it the perfect place to start saving. Planning ahead and using online discount travel sites can yield significant savings, even after accounting for service fees around $5.

Consider these flight booking strategies:

  • Book connecting flights instead of direct routes—they're typically much cheaper
  • Choose roundtrip tickets over one-way fares for better deals
  • Pack light to avoid excess baggage fees that can quickly add up
  • Be flexible with dates to take advantage of lower mid-week prices

Ground Transportation That Won't Ground Your Budget

Transportation costs can consume up to 30% of your travel budget if you're not careful. Skip the expensive airport taxis and welcome services that prey on tired travelers.

Instead, embrace these budget-friendly options:

  • Public transportation like buses and subways offer authentic local experiences
  • Car rentals for small groups, especially compact cars for better gas mileage
  • Overnight travel by bus or train to save on a night's accommodation

Accommodation: Sleep Well Without Overspending

Your choice of accommodation can make or break your travel budget. Hotels aren't always your best option, especially for longer stays or group travel.

Smart Lodging Alternatives

For stays longer than two days, vacation rentals often provide better value than hotels. You'll get more space, kitchen facilities to prepare your own meals, and often a more authentic local experience.

When hotels are your preference:

  • Choose two-bedroom suites instead of separate rooms when traveling with family
  • Look for properties with complimentary breakfast to save on morning meals
  • Consider locations slightly outside city centers for significant savings

Food and Dining: Taste Local Without Overspending

Food expenses can quickly spiral out of control without proper planning. The key is balancing memorable dining experiences with budget-conscious choices.

Strategic Meal Planning

Research local dining options before you arrive. This prevents expensive impulse decisions when you're hungry and unfamiliar with your surroundings.

Money-saving food strategies include:

  • Skip hotel breakfasts—grab pastries from local cafes the night before
  • Cook some meals yourself if your accommodation has kitchen facilities
  • Explore local markets for fresh ingredients and authentic experiences
  • Mix splurge meals with budget-friendly options throughout your trip

Money Matters: Currency and Shopping Savvy

Navigate Exchange Rates Like a Pro

Currency fluctuations can impact your buying power significantly. Monitor exchange rates before and during your trip, and research money changers that offer competitive rates rather than using airport exchanges.

Smart Shopping Strategies

No vacation is complete without bringing home memories and souvenirs. Take advantage of duty-free shops at airports for tax-free purchases on items like perfumes, alcohol, and chocolates.

For local souvenirs, venture beyond tourist areas to find authentic items at better prices. Local markets and neighborhood shops often offer unique finds at a fraction of tourist trap costs.
